The Aurignacian Museum is a site museum located in Haute-Garonne, in the municipality of Aurignac, in a rural area. It is dedicated to prehistory and is organized around a local prehistoric shelter. The museum offers guided tours and walks to the archaeological site, as well as workshops for all audiences. It also hosts regular programming combining temporary exhibitions, lectures and events related to archaeology and prehistory. The facilities are accessible to visitors with disabilities.
